Development of positron emitting radionuclides for imaging with improved positron detectors
Description
Recent advances in positron cameras and positron ring detectors for transverse section reconstruction have created renewed interest in positron emitting radionuclides. This paper reports on: generator-produced 82Rb; cyclotron-produced 62Zn; and reactor-produced 64Cu. Investigation of the 82Sr (25 d)--82Rb (75 s) generator determined the elution characteristics for Bio-Rex 70, a weakly acidic carboxylic cation exchanger, using 2% NaCl as the eluent. The yield of 82Rb and the breakthrough of 82Sr were determined for newly prepared columns and for long term elution conditions. Spallation-produced 82Sr was used to charge a compact 82Rb generator to obtain multi-millicurie amounts of 82Rb for myocardial imaging. Zinc accumulates in the islet cells of the pancreas and in the prostate. Zinc-62 was produced by protons on Cu foil and separated by column chromatography. Zinc-62 was administered as the amino acid chelates and as the ZnCl2 to tumor and normal animals. Tissue distribution was determined for various times after intravenous injection. Pancreas-liver images of 62Zn-histidine uptake were obtained in animals with the gamma camera and the liver uptake of /sup 99m/Tc sulfur colloid was computer subtracted to image the pancreas alone. The positron camera imaged uptake of 62Zn-histidine in the prostate of a dog at 20 h. 64Cu was chelated to asparagine, a requirement of leukemic cells, and administered to lymphoma mice. Uptake in tumor and various tissues was determined and compared with the uptake of 67Ga citrate under the same conditions. 64Cu-asparagine had better tumor-to-soft tissue ratios than 67Ga-citrate
